Ensuring Compliance and Accuracy

Running your payroll through a payroll provider helps you stay in compliance. Considering all you and your small business clients have on your minds, it’s hard to stay on top of constantly changing tax laws. Letting an online payroll provider assist with your client’s tax filings adds another layer of security and accuracy that could save them from a costly mistake. SurePayroll knows that even the smallest violation could be an expense a small business isn’t prepared for, and therefore offers a tax filing guarantee – if your client receives a notice from the IRS or any other tax agency based on a filing that SurePayroll made on their behalf, SurePayroll will work with the agency to resolve the issue. If we’re at fault, we’ll pay all associated penalties and fines.

Stand Out from the Crowd

The payroll market is virtually untapped. A recent survey showed that nearly 43% of accounting firms say that their clients need assistance with payroll, but nearly 9/10 accountants stated that they had little to no interest in providing payroll as a service. These numbers mean less competition for you: you’ll be one of the much-needed providers of a service that everyone needs!
